Distributed Computing and Cache Networks
Lab49's Large Scale Computing practice has been working on multiple client projects where grid computing, distributed caching and event processing have been key to gaining competitive advantage. Additionally, we have experience in implementing various technology vendor solutions:
- Grid Computing: Datasynapse, Platform, Windows Cluster Server
- Distributed Cache and Data Fabric technologies: GemFire, Gigaspaces, JBoss Cache, ScaleOut Software, Tangosol
- Complex Event processing (CEP) and Event Stream Processing (ESP): BEA Weblogic Event Server, Coral8, Esper, Progress Apama, Streambase
